  1. Install the left engine mount strut bracket.
  2. Install the engine mount strut bracket bolts through the engine mount strut bracket to the cylinder head.

    TightenΒ 

    Tighten the engine mount strut bracket bolts to 70 N.m (52 lb ft).

  3. Install the thermostat housing.

  4. Install the left engine mount strut to the left engine mount strut bracket. Refer to ENGINE MOUNT STRUT REPLACEMENT - LEFTΒ  .

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• β€’ You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• β€’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• β€’ The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• β€’ You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• β€’ You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
